Step 1: Conducting a Risk Assessment
The first step in developing a robust construction and heavy civil safety management strategy involves conducting a thorough risk assessment. This process identifies potential hazards associated with construction activities and formulates strategies to mitigate these risks.
- Identify Hazards: Analyze the work environment, equipment, and operations to pinpoint potential hazards. Common risks include falls, machinery accidents, and exposure to harmful substances.
- Evaluate Risks: Examine the likelihood and severity of identified hazards. Use tools such as risk matrices to quantify the risk levels.
- Implement Controls: Prioritize risk control measures, focusing on elimination, substitution, engineering controls, administrative controls, and personal protective equipment (PPE).
By systematically addressing these aspects, companies can begin to formulate an effective OSHA construction safety program.
Step 2: Developing a Site Safety Plan
A comprehensive site safety plan serves as the foundation of construction safety management. This document outlines the safety policies, procedures, and practices that must be followed on-site. Key components include:
- Emergency Response Plan: Establish procedures for responding to emergencies, including injuries and environmental hazards.
- Training Programs: Define training requirements for all workers and supervisors specific to the site hazards.
- Communication Strategies: Implement clear communication channels to relay safety information and updates.
Additionally, ensure that the site safety plan is regularly reviewed and updated to reflect changes in operations or regulations.
Pricing Structure for Safety Management Consulting Services
Understanding the pricing structure for safety management consulting services is essential for budgeting and resource allocation. Prices can vary significantly based on the complexity of the project, level of expertise required, and regional cost factors. Below are the main factors influencing pricing:
1. Scope of Services
The range of services provided by safety consultants can dramatically affect pricing. Typical offerings include:
- Audits and Assessments: Comprehensive evaluations to identify compliance gaps.
- Training and Development: Custom or standard training programs to ensure worker competencies.
- Ongoing Support: Continuous monitoring and updates to safety programs.
2. Experience and Credentials
Consultants with specialized expertise in construction safety management practices may command higher fees. Verify credentials and seek consultants that offer certifications from recognized organizations or comply with OSHA guidelines.
3. Geographic Considerations
Costs can also vary based on geographical location, reflecting local economic conditions and industry standards. In the US, the price may range significantly between urban and rural areas.
4. Engagement Duration
The duration and intensity of engagement will also impact costs. Short-term engagements may have a higher hourly rate, while long-term contracts may offer a lower rate due to the commitment.
Estimating Costs for Compliance Audits
When estimating the costs associated with compliance audits, it is essential to break down the components of the audit process:
1. Initial Consultation
Most consulting services offer a preliminary consultation to understand your specific needs. This phase may be free or charged at a nominal rate, potentially setting the stage for further collaboration.
2. On-Site Assessment
An on-site compliance audit involves systematic inspections, interviews with employees, and a review of existing documentation. Costs here could range from $2,000 to $15,000, depending on the size of the project and the number of consultants required.
3. Reporting and Recommendations
After the audit, consultants will typically generate a report outlining findings and recommendations. The billing for this report may vary based on the depth of analysis and the complexity of the issues identified.
4. Follow-Up Support
Ongoing support post-audit may include additional training sessions, updated policies, and help with implementing recommendations. This may come at an hourly rate or as a fixed-price contract, determined based on the client’s needs.
Fall Protection and Scaffolding Rules
In construction, fall protection is a critical element of safety management due to the high incidence of workplace falls. Adhering to proper fall protection and scaffolding rules is not just a regulatory requirement but a moral obligation to protect workers.
Understanding OSHA’s Fall Protection Standards
Under OSHA regulations (29 CFR 1926.501), employers are required to provide fall protection systems for employees working at heights of six feet or more in the construction industry. This includes the use of guardrails, safety nets, and personal fall arrest systems.
Scaffolding Safety Compliance
According to OSHA scaffolding regulations, all scaffolding must be erected and maintained according to manufacturer’s specifications and OSHA guidelines. Compliance includes ensuring:
- The structure can support a minimum of four times the intended load.
- All platforms are fully planked.
- Guardrails are installed on all open sides and ends.
Regular inspections and training for employees who work on or with scaffolding must be scheduled to maintain safety compliance.
Crane and Lifting Safety Compliance
Crane operations present significant hazards in the construction industry. Effective crane and lifting safety compliance can minimize these dangers, ensuring a safe working environment.
OSHA Regulations for Crane Operations
Employers are tasked with ensuring that crane operations comply with OSHA crane regulations. Key compliance factors include:
- Plant and Equipment Safety: Ensure all cranes are inspected regularly and maintained as per manufacturer specifications.
- Training and Certification: Operators must receive proper training and certification to operate cranes safely.
- Site Assessments: Conduct site evaluations to recognize and mitigate potential hazards related to crane operations, such as proximity to power lines.
Developing a Lifting Plan
All lifting operations should have a documented lifting plan that outlines the process, equipment to be used, and the roles of all personnel involved. This helps to ensure safety and compliance during the lifting operation.
